Oyster Roast w/ Bowens Island

February 22, 2020 1:00 pm - 5:00 pm
Holy City Brewing has a new location in Park Circle at 1021 Aragon Avenue, which features a very large, spacious backyard that sits on Noisette Creek. We are starting to throw events on the back of our property, and the first one is on February 22nd, 2020 from 1-5pm. We are throwing an oyster roast!
Bowens Island will be providing the oysters for the event, as we have collaborated in the past. Live music will be performed by Stephen Jenkins and Friends from 1:30-4:30pm. We will host the roast in our yard on picnic tables, and anyone who purchases a wristband is more than welcome to take place in the feast that day.
Wristbands will cost $25, and that includes all-you-can-eat oysters. Other people who wish to visit the taproom can attend normally, as our kitchen will be serving food from our normal menu as well and our bar will be pouring offerings of our beer as well as full wine and liquor selections. All wristbands will be purchased day-of, and can be added to guests’ bar tabs, as simple as that. All someone has to do to get a wristband is chat with a bartender. Advanced tickets purchased by people online will be honored day-of, if anyone who bought a ticket before is worried about getting it redeemed.
Parking is on-site, as we have a large lot. Overflow can park up and down Aragon Avenue in the appropriate spaces.
This is the first event in a series of concerts, markets and other soirees that we will host in our backyard marshside. We’ve got a ton of land out behind our brewhouse, and with such a beautiful backdrop, we’d hate for any opportunities to go to waste.
